My Attendance

Your own attendance month by month: in and out times, gross, net and overtime hours, breaks and the raw scans behind each day, with a way to report a day that looks wrong to HR.

What this screen is for

This shows the attendance the system recorded for you. Pick a month and each day is listed as present, absent, on leave or late, with in time, out time, break, gross hours, net hours and overtime, plus the scans that produced those figures. Where the scans are odd, an odd number or an overrunning break, the day is flagged, and a day signed out after midnight is marked as such. A month total sits alongside.

When to use it

Check it before payroll closes. The figures shown are exactly what the scans produced, so if a day is wrong, use Report a Problem on that day to describe what happened and send a correction request to HR. The request's status, approved, declined or withdrawn, is shown against the day.

What you see on this screen

A line under the heading names the shift you are measured against, with its start and end, the length of the working day and the grace period. Where no shift is assigned, it says so, and explains that lateness and overtime cannot be measured without one.

Tiles across the top: Present, Absent, Half Day, On Leave, Net Hrs (with the gross less break shown beneath), Break Overruns, OT Hrs and Late Entries.

The table has these columns: Date, Status, In Time, Out Time, Gross Hrs, Break, Net Hrs, OT Hrs, Late and Remarks.

Under each date is a scan count you can open to see the scans recorded, with a warning where there is an odd number and one is probably missing. An out time that crossed midnight carries a +1 day marker. The break cell reads none, the amount it ran over, or the number of breaks, and is flagged for checking where it looks wrong. A Month total row closes the table, with present days out of days recorded.

Filters and actions

A month picker in the header chooses the month. Each real row has a Report a problem link, which opens a form showing what was recorded and asking what is wrong, with optional corrected in and out times. A note states that this sends your note to HR and that nothing changes on your record until they approve it. Once raised, the row carries a badge and a link to withdraw the request.

Status values

A day is recorded as Present, Absent, Half Day, On Leave, Holiday or Weekly Off. Today shows as Not Marked until something is recorded.

A correction request shows as Correction requested while pending, then Correction approved, Correction declined, or Request withdrawn where you took it back.
